The team chooses one person to begin drawing this position rotates with each word. The first player to land and guess correctly at the finish wins. To achieve this a player must guess the word or phrase being drawn by their partner, or if the player lands on an "all play" square, one player from each team attempts to illustrate the same concept simultaneously, with the two teams racing to guess first. The objective is to be the first team to reach the last space on the board. Each square has a letter or shape identifying the type of picture to be drawn on it. At that time they were in 60 countries and 45 languages, with 11 versions just in the US and a total of 32,000,000 games sold worldwide.Įach team moves a piece on a game board formed by a sequence of squares. In 1994, Hasbro took over publishing after acquiring the games business of Western Publishing. Īngel Games licensed the game in 1986 in a joint venture between The Games Gang and Western Publishing. They managed to sell 6,000 copies in one year at $35 each. Angel and his partners had to sort through the cards themselves over the course of six days. A week before Pictionary was first launched, Angel Games' printing company called to inform them that they could not sort through the 500,000 cards they had printed out. Īngel and his business partners Terry Langston and Gary Everson first published Pictionary in 1985 through Angel Games. While originally hesitant to pitch the idea, Angel was inspired by Trivial Pursuit, the gameplay of which was similar to his concept and proved to him that such gameplay could work and be successful. Angel and his roommates came up with the concept of the game, which proved to be very popular between them. The concept of Pictionary was first created by Robert Angel and his friends in 1981. The game is played in teams with players trying to identify specific words from their teammates. Mattel acquired ownership of Pictionary in 2001. Hasbro purchased the rights in 1994 after acquiring the games business of Western Publishing. Angel Games licensed Pictionary to Western Publishing. Pictionary ( / ˈ p ɪ k ʃ ən ər i/, US: /- ɛr i/) is a charades-inspired word-guessing game invented by Robert Angel with graphic design by Gary Everson and first published in 1985 by Angel Games Inc.

Nintendo periodically released special Miis, usually during E3 or to commemorate game and franchise anniversaries. Because the selection of facial features is considered by some to be limited, users are encouraged to develop caricatures of real persons instead of accurate depictions. These versions also have more options than their Wii counterpart. The features can then be fine-tuned by the user. The Mii Maker installed on the Nintendo 3DS and Wii U can use facial recognition to generate a Mii, which selects facial features based on a photograph of a person's face taken with the system's and GamePad's cameras respectively. Accessories such as hats and glasses are also available to add, and the Mii's height and build can also be adjusted. Most of the facial features can be further adjusted, including their size, position, color, and alignment. While the user can assign a gender, name, birthday, favorite color, and mingle preference to a Mii, the majority of the interface used for Mii creation focuses on the appearance of its face and head: the user is given a variety of different hairstyles, eye, nose, and mouth shapes, and other features such as facial hair or wrinkles, to select from. Mii characters are created and stored in the Mii Channel or the Mii Maker, which are pre-installed on the Wii and the Nintendo 3DS/ Wii U/ Nintendo Switch consoles respectively. The Mii Channel, the first application used to create and view Mii characters on the Wii Nintendo designer Yamashita Takayuki attributes his work on Talent Studio as having been foundational to his eventual work on the Mii, which was necessitated by the development of the game Wii Sports. This software, renamed to Manebito, was discontinued prior to release. Miyamoto showed another short film they made with this software, which was shown at E3 2002 with the name Stage Debut. Along with the Game Boy Camera, it can build an avatar maker. The next avatar implementation was for the Nintendo e-Reader and GameCube. The player can optionally utilize the Game Boy Camera and the 64DD's Capture Cassette to put their own face upon the avatar. Nintendo had produced a short film using the 64DD's Mario Artist: Talent Studio 's avatar maker, which includes clothes and a built-in movie editor. In 1999, the 64DD (a disk drive peripheral for the N64) was launched in Japan. Miyamoto commented that the concept could not be turned into a game and the concept was suspended. There, Shigeru Miyamoto said that the personal avatar concept had originally been intended as a Famicom demo, where a user could draw a face onto an avatar. Nintendo's first public debut of free-form personal avatar software was at the Game Developers Conference in 1997, during the Nintendo 64 era. U Deluxe use Miis as playable characters. Games such as Wii Sports, Wii Sports Resort, Mario Kart Wii, Mario Kart 8, Go Vacation, Super Mario Maker 2, Super Smash Bros. Miis are also used as profile pictures for Nintendo Accounts and can be used in Nintendo smart device games such as Super Mario Run, Mario Kart Tour and the now-defunct Miitomo. On the Nintendo Switch, a Mii can still be used as an account avatar, but avatars depicting various Nintendo characters are also available. On the 3DS and Wii U, user accounts are associated with a Mii as their avatar and used as the basis of the systems' social networking features, most prominently the now-defunct Miiverse. Miis can be shared and transferred between consoles, either manually or automatically with other users over the internet and local wireless communications. Miis can be created using different body, facial and clothing features, and can then be used as characters within games on the consoles, either as an avatar of a specific player (such as in the Wii series) or in some games (such as Tomodachi Life and Miitopia) portrayed as characters with their own personalities. Miis were first introduced on the Wii console in 2006 and later appeared on the 3DS, Wii U, the Switch, and various apps for smart devices. The name Mii is a portmanteau of “Wii” and “me”, referring to them typically being avatars of the players. The male and female default Miis as shown on the WiiĪ Mii ( / m iː/ MEE) is a customizable avatar used on several Nintendo video game consoles and mobile apps. Winifred Bird: Your article about the Hachinohe Wild Boar Famine describes an episode in far-northern Honshu in the mid-1700s, where farmers started growing soybeans as a cash crop to send to Edo (now Tokyo), and to do that they used slash and burn agriculture. Winifred Bird spoke with him by telephone at his office in Bozeman. Walker is Regents’ Professor and department chair of history and philosophy at Montanta State University, Bozeman. Often, he traces the roots of environmental destruction much further into the past than we commonly assume they reach. Always, the stories he tells are unflinching, impressively researched, and eloquently written. Since then he has documented how trade and conquest transformed Hokkaido’s landscape (The Conquest of Ainu Lands: Ecology and Culture in Japanese Expansion, 1590-1800, 2001) how modernization drove wolves to extinction (The Lost Wolves of Japan, 2005) and how workers, farmers, mothers, and babies have paid in pain for the industrial development of Japan (Toxic Archipelago, 2010). While there he befriended some scholars who encouraged him to study its history more seriously he did so, gaining his Ph.D from the University of Oregon in Japanese history in 1997. After graduating he traveled to Hokkaido, teaching at a juku and falling in love with the country. Walker says he “stumbled on Japan” as an undergraduate history student in Idaho. Yet it is industrial civilization as a whole, rather than a uniquely Japanese interpretation of it, that his books condemn. As he acknowledges-without apology-in the prologue to his most recent book, Toxic Archipelago: A History of Industrial Disease in Japan, the patterns he finds are often dark ones: “I am a historian and I am calling it as I see it, and I see environmental decline and deterioration everywhere,” he writes. He treats economics, folklore, ecology, family history, and politics not as independent disciplines but as threads that wrap together into episodes, which in turn accumulate into the patterns that give history meaning. History as Walker writes it is as seamlessly complex as life outside of books. This powerful, probing book demonstrates how the Japanese archipelago has become industrialized over the last two hundred years - and how people and the environment have suffered as a consequence.Any student of Japan who is tempted to idealize, or simplify, the way people in this country have historically interacted with nature would do well to search out the writing of environmental historian Brett Walker. Brett Walker examines startling case studies of industrial toxins that know no boundaries: deaths from insecticide contaminations poisonings from copper, zinc, and lead mining congenital deformities from methylmercury factory effluents and lung diseases from sulfur dioxide and asbestos. Toxic Archipelago explores how toxic pollution works its way into porous human bodies and brings unimaginable pain to some of them. Toxins moved freely from mines, factory sites, and rice paddies into human bodies. Nowhere is this truer than on the Japanese archipelago.ĭuring the nineteenth century, Japan saw the rise of Homo sapiens industrialis, a new breed of human transformed by an engineered, industrialized, and poisonous environment. Our lives depend on these relationships - and are imperiled by them as well. On the mound, the Vikings deployed six different arms with Jadrien Keavy getting the win going the first two innings. Hopper also posted three hits in the game, while Fest and Russell each added two. Peterson led the Bethany hitters in the contest, going 3-of-3 with four runs scored. In the seventh, the Vikings would plate their final run of the game after a few wild pitches to achieve the 10-run rule. In the fifth inning and with the Vikings leading 6-0, Eli Fest would rope a base hit up the middle to score Hopper, before Peterson connected for the Vikings first home run of the season to give Bethany a 9-0 lead. Russell would then bring the next run across in the fourth inning when he singled in a run with Matt Verdugo following him up with an RBI in the next AB. After Peterson drew a walk in the second inning, Aidan Russell would gap a triple to left center to score him and put the Vikings up 4-0. Henry Laue followed that at-bat with a sac fly to plate Matt Verdugo before Ben Hopper got a base hit up the middle to bring Vaughn Pouncy across and make it 3-0 after one inning of play. With the win the Vikings improve to 4-5 overall and 1-0 in the conference while the Knights fall to 3-6 overall and 0-1 in the UMAC.īethany got the scoring started in the first when Brad Bickmann ripped a single through the left side to bring home Liam Peterson. The Bethany Lutheran baseball team had a solid showing in its home opener on Tuesday with a convincing 10-0 win over Martin Luther College.
